软探针程序是什么

时间:2025-01-17 18:13:56 热门攻略

软件探针程序是一种 用于监控、收集和分析软件系统性能的工具。它通过在软件代码中插入特定的监测点(称为探针)来实现对系统运行状态的实时监测和调试。探针编程的主要组成部分包括:

探针定义:

确定需要监测的目标和采集的数据类型,包括探针名称、目标对象和数据类型等信息。

数据采集:

编写代码从目标对象中获取所需数据,并存储到变量或数据结构中。

数据处理:

编写代码对采集到的数据进行处理和分析,例如计算统计指标或进行数据筛选和过滤。

数据存储:

编写代码将处理后的数据存储到数据库、文件系统或其他存储介质中。

探针编程程序的目标是实现对目标对象的监测和数据采集,并对采集到的数据进行处理、存储和展示,以便用户能够更好地了解和分析监测对象的状态和性能。

此外,探针编程还可以用于计算机网络和系统性能的监控,通过监测各种指标(如CPU利用率、内存使用情况、网络流量等)来识别潜在问题,并采取相应措施。

总的来说,软件探针程序是一种重要的软件开发技术,它通过在代码中插入探针来实现对系统运行状态的监测和调试,帮助开发人员快速定位和解决问题,提高软件质量和开发效率。